How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 19108?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 19108 Studio Apartments | $1,813 | $647 | $10,981 |
| 19108 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,317 | $425 | $14,274 |
| 19108 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,032 | $725 | $13,007 |
| 19108 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,585 | $625 | $15,000 |
| 19108 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,978 | $585 | $24,995 |
| 19108 5 Bedroom Apartments | $2,844 | $1,600 | $5,000 |
| 19108 6 Bedroom Apartments | $2,984 | $525 | $4,500 |
